Transaction 8a878a2567589c5d6a85faee97634c98d71a7063e3f99571814feabbb5283b0a
1 Input
2 Outputs
- 8a878a2567589c5d6a85faee97634c98d71a7063e3f99571814feabbb5283b0a:0
- 8a878a2567589c5d6a85faee97634c98d71a7063e3f99571814feabbb5283b0a:1
value 6205390
address 17piTrCHmDVgGyxoNPDyCGytfQ1wSMWMdw
value 133962202
address 14VquSqxnJnuGDunXRtmdSowBdBifrnxFN